Output ddbbdd31c801317c705948fb53c828210ea45e031b349419e6f453077b03154e:3

value
2506615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a93474546bad60ce42c0a3aeed11543856a799b OP_EQUAL
address
372jYkc1yd2higTHSspcJb8ntGJZAZgW6k
transaction
ddbbdd31c801317c705948fb53c828210ea45e031b349419e6f453077b03154e
spent
true